About Rogers State University
Rogers State University was established in 1909 and continues today as a public, co-educational institution located in the town of Claremore, Oklahoma. RSU was founded as a state-sponsored preparatory school called Eastern University Preparatory School. Later the institution transitioned into Oklahoma Military Academy and finally into a four-year university. The school has branch campuses in Bartlesville, Oklahoma, and Pryor Creek, Oklahoma. Today it provides “…a general liberal arts education that supports specialized academic programs and prepares students for lifelong learning and service in a diverse society.”
RSU offers master’s, bachelor’s, and associate’s degrees. Rogers State was the first university in Oklahoma and one of the first in the United States to offer degree programs in a completely online format over the internet. Since 1992 RSU online degrees have been highly regarded academic programs. Today associate’s, bachelor’s, and master’s degrees, as well as certificates, are available as online programs.
